一、数据库配置1、创建数据库1.管理员连接数据库 >: mysql -uroot -proot 2.创建数据库 >: create database luffy default charset=utf8; 3.查看用户 >: select user,host,password from mysql.user; # 查看用户(5.7往后版本) >: select us
MySQL是一个数据库集成开发工具(也可叫MySQL服务器),可以在MySQL里面创建自己定义各种数据库,但是MySQL一旦安装好了,就会有初始一些数据库,这些数据库MySQL配置、权限等等这类似的系统级数据库,比如MySQL工具中有一个mysql数据库,里面就有user表格用于存储整个MySQL用户信息。MySQL服务器里有个mysql数据库,里面有很多表,用于存储各种信息,比如:用
转载 2023-08-18 19:03:16
304阅读
前言想必玩过mysql的人对Waiting for table metadata lock肯定不会陌生,一般都是进行alter操作时被堵住了,导致了我们在show processlist 时,看到线程状态是在等metadata lock。本文会对MySQL结构变更Metadata Lock进行详细介绍。在线上进行DDL操作时,相对于其可能带来系统负载,其实,我们最担心还是MDL其可能导
# 如何实现“mysql数据库没有user” ## 引言 在mysql数据库user是管理用户权限重要表格之一。但是有时候,我们可能需要重新创建一个没有usermysql数据库。本文将详细介绍如何实现这个目标,并提供步骤、代码和注释来帮助你理解每一步操作。 ## 一、步骤概述 下面的表格展示了实现“mysql数据库没有user步骤概述: | 步骤 | 操作 | | -
原创 2023-10-18 04:15:02
348阅读
数据库1、键:主键是标志列。一个键可能由几列组成。可以使用键作为表格之间引用。 CustomerID是Customers主键,当它出现在其他,例如Orders时候就称它为外键。2、模式数据库整套表格完整设计称为数据库模式。一个模式应该显示表格及表格列、每个主键和外键。一个模式并不会包含任何数据,但是我们可能希望在模式里使用示例数据来解析这些数据含义。例如:
转载 2023-08-16 00:21:33
137阅读
mysql数据库,使用select user();查看当前用户。mysqlhost字段%与localhost不是谁包括谁问题,是由模糊到精确进行匹配: 当用户从客户端请求登陆时,MySQL将授权条目与客户端所提供条目进行比较,包括用户用户名,密码和主机。授权Host字段是可以使用通配符作为模式进行匹配,如test.example.com, %.example.com,
MySQL用户管理:              ①  root用户是超级管理员,拥有所有权限。            &nbsp
下文对MysqlUser权限字段进行了全部详细说明,供您参考学习,如果您对Mysql User权限字段不是很了解,不妨一看,相信对您会有所启迪。Select_priv。确定用户是否可以通过SELECT命令选择数据。Insert_priv。确定用户是否可以通过INSERT命令插入数据。Update_priv。确定用户是否可以通过UPDATE命令修改现有数据。Delete_priv。确定用户是否
转载 2023-09-01 17:57:59
82阅读
工作难免要更新MySQL数据结构,在本地可以使用phpMyadmin之类工具方便修改,线上一般没有权限,就需要上服务器手敲sql了。在此总结一下MySQL修改结构方法。1.添加表字段alter table table1 add transactor varchar(10) not Null;2.修改表字段alter table 名称 change 原字段名 新字段名 字段类型 [是否
转载 2023-05-26 16:36:52
77阅读
一、mysql体系结构。1、连接层。2、服务层。3、引擎层(索引是在存储引擎层实现)。4、存储层。二、存储引擎。存储引擎是存储数据、建立索引、更新/查询数据等技术实现方式。存储引擎是基于,而不是基于,所以存储引擎也可被称为类型。1、在创建时,指定存储引擎。CREATE TABLE 名( 字段1 字段1类型 [COMMFNT 字段1注释], ...... 字段n 字段n类型 [CO
# MySQL 数据库用户密码加密实现教程 在现代应用开发,密码安全性至关重要。当我们存储用户密码时,必须确保这些密码是加密过,以防止在数据库泄漏时用户信息被恶意获取。在本文中,我将引导你实现 MySQL 数据库用户密码加密。我们将逐步进行,涵盖每个步骤所需代码及其解释。 ## 一、整体流程 在开始之前,首先我们需要了解整个过程步骤,下面是流程表格: | 步骤
原创 2月前
66阅读
数据库作用:1、有结构存储大量数据。2、有效保持数据一致性。3、方便智能分析,产生新有用信息。4、满足应用共享和安全要求。 关系型数据库基本组成:一个数据库是由一组数据(table)组成。2、每一行成为记录(record)。3、数据库作用:1、有结构存储大量数据。2、有效保持数据一致性。3、方便智能分析,产生新有用信息。4、满足应用共享和安全要求。关
用户信息( act_id_user )字段名称字段描述数据类型主键为空取值说明ID_ID_nvarchar
原创 2022-09-07 06:54:10
96阅读
1.创建和查看数据库数据库数据:是数据库最重要组成部分之一,是其他对象基础。如下图就是一个数据库数据:创建数据库创建数据语句为 CREATE TABLE* CREATE TABLE<名> ( 列名1 数据类型[列级别约束条件][默认值], 列名2 数据类型[列级别约束条件][默认值], … [级别约束条件] ); 上述创建语句中[]表示不是必须要写,需要
MYSQL一、MYSQL数据库1.常看当前数据库有哪些2.查看数据库3.查看数据库结构3.1结构各个属性涵义:3.2.常用数据类型:二、SQL语句1.定义:2.SQL分类3.创建数据库(DDL)4.删除5.增(INSERT) 改(UPDATE)删除(DELETE)5.1 插入新数据(INSERT)5.2更新原有数据(UPDATE)5.3 删除数据(DETELE)6.查询
转载 2023-06-20 10:51:14
2008阅读
1.索引组织数据存储是按照主键顺序来;在InnoDB,每个都有主键 Primary Key;若没有显示设置,会默认设置主键唯一索引为主键上述不满足 创建一个6byte 指针2.InnoDB逻辑存储2.1 空间tablespace 前面说过了如果配置了innodb_file_per_table=ON 就是一张一个空间但是呢 这样每张空间存储数据有:数据,索引,insert
在别人方法上做了修改。1、mysql workbench 菜单file=>add model(添加模型)点击上面的add diagram(添加新图解),就会在右边多出一个新图解模型2,mysql workbench 菜单database=>reverse engineer mysql workbench 连接数据库 填写好连接信息后,一直下一步就OK了,这样就能
索引是帮助MySQL高效获取数据排好序数据结构。一张数据在磁盘上面是随机分布,不一定数据绝对是相邻,如果要从磁盘上拿取一行记录,需要与磁盘做IO交互,交互越多,越消耗性能。(索引也是存储在磁盘上)索引是一种数据结构数据结构有:二叉树(二叉查找树Binary Search Tree)、红黑树(Red Black Tree)、Hash、B-Tree、B+Tree索引详解:1.假设索
一,添加数据库用户 1.MySQL权限 MySQL通过权限来控制用户对数据库访问,MySQL数据库在安装时会自动安装多个数据库MySQL权限存放在名称为MySQL数据库。常用权限user、db、host、table_priv、columns_priv和procs_priv.(1)user权限userMySQL中最重要一个权限user列主要分为4个部分:用户列、权限
前言 新建MySQL时,会自动安装一个mysql数据库,该数据库下面的都是权限。 其中:user是最重要权限。记录了允许连接到服务器账号信息以及一些全局权限信息。 user有42个字段,大致分为4类:用户列、权限列、安全列及资源控制列。 mysql用户host字段,如果host设置不正确,可能导致无法连接mysql数据库user_name@host_name,其中host_n
转载 2023-08-30 15:32:42
312阅读
  • 1
  • 2
  • 3
  • 4
  • 5